Transaction 870d9986b9c3094729e0493e05768e34acb860aba2f06ec9b640bd7936ffee50
1 Input
2 Outputs
- 870d9986b9c3094729e0493e05768e34acb860aba2f06ec9b640bd7936ffee50:0
- 870d9986b9c3094729e0493e05768e34acb860aba2f06ec9b640bd7936ffee50:1
value 718110000
address 1B8Wnwuh1sbP5UQjMXoQ87NUXLXpDMP9nb
value 1923574143
address 3MChnsYGM3h1bG9BVY2kuWh3qpFXR14qxh